Sensex plunges around 1300 points
The stock markets have plunged at opening bell, in line with the sell-off witnessed across the world, as the spread of coronavirus across the world is stoking fears of a prolonged global economic slowdown. The BSE Sensex was at 37,180, weaker by 1,300 points and the SGX Nifty was at 10,881, down 385 points in early trades.
